The late 2003-2007 Ford F-series super-duty trucks came equipped with a 6.0L Powerstroke diesel engine making them a powerhouse and great work trucks. However, they have some shortcomings that gave these engines a bad reputation. We brought in two different models of these trucks to dissect and investigate the issues. What we came up with is our upgraded 6061 aluminum HPS Cold Side and Hot Side Charge Pipe Kit that addresses the weak links in the charge air system.

Difference between HPS Complete Charge Pipes Kit and other aftermarket kits are listed below.

HPS Hot Side Charge Pipe with Mounting Brace
The factory Hot Side is commonly known to fail at the turbo boots. We found that the factory steel Hot Side pipe is a major culprit in causing boost leaks and power loss problems on all years of the 6.0L Powerstroke Diesel engine. The factory Hot Side pipe sits in the engine compartment freely with nothing holding it in place except for the boots, placing a lot of stress on the boots. Our approach to this issue is to create the pipe out of 6061 aluminum tubing to reduce the weight on the boots by about 50%. On top of that, we designed a brace to securely mount the Hot Side pipe, further relieving any weight and stress from the boots.

HPS Cold Side Charge Pipe
When the 6.0L Powerstroke Ford F-Series first came out, it was equipped with plated steel pipes for both hot and cold side. The pipes were heavy as well as robust. During the mid-cycle refresh for the 2005 models, the cold side pipe was replaced to an injection molded plastic charge pipe. Owners of these trucks would begin noticing loss of power caused by cracks in the plastic pipe. The HPS Cold Side Charge Pipe, modeled off of the OEM part, replaces the OEM hard and brittle plastic charge pipe with our mandrel bent 6061 aluminum piece. Our aluminum Cold Side Charge Pipe is also an upgrade to early model steel pipes for those who want to reduce weight and simply want to add some color to the engine compartment.

HPS Ultra High Temp 4-ply Aramid Reinforced Fluoro-lined Silicone Boots
In our analysis, the stock intercooler boots are made of silicone and is reinforced with 2 layers of polyester. Because the 6.0L Powerstroke engines breathe a lot of oil through the turbo, silicone hoses will degrade causing them to become soft and gummy. Over time, the boots will either rip or blow through. On our HPS direct fit intercooler boots for the 6.0L Powerstroke Diesel Ford F-Series trucks, we added a fluoroelastomer liner to allow constant flow of oil without the negative consequences. We also replaced the 2 layers of polyester with 4 layers of Aramid fiber, raising the maximum operating temperature to 500F. The added layers also plays a role in allowing higher operating pressures, keeping your truck on the road longer.

HPS Heavy Duty Spring-Loaded T-Bolt Clamps
We provide Stainless Steel Spring-Loaded T-Bolt clamps with our intercooler boot kits on every connecting point of the charge air system for the 6.0L Powerstroke Diesel Ford F-Series trucks. The housing and band are made of a 300 series stainless steel and offer great corrosion resistance. The Bolt, Nut, and Spring are zinc plated steel for excellent reusability and protection from the elements.

REMARK: The complete kit for the 6.0L Powerstroke Diesel Ford F-Series trucks is designed and modeled based on OEM parts. This kit will work with direct bolt-on intake kits as well as direct fit upgraded intercoolers.

Alexander the Great is one of the most prominent figures in ancient history, known for his military conquests and political prowess. Born in 356 BCE in Pella, the ancient capital of Macedonia, Alexander was the son of King Philip II and Queen Olympia. From an early age, Alexander was groomed for leadership and given a rigorous education in military strategy, politics, and philosophy under the tutelage of Aristotle. When Alexander was only 20 years old, he succeeded his father as king of Macedonia. Immediately upon taking the throne, he set his sights on expanding his empire. In 334 BCE, Alexander led an army of approximately 35,000 soldiers across the Hellespont, a narrow strait that separates Europe and Asia. This marked the beginning of his campaign to conquer the Persian Empire. Over the course of the next decade, Alexander achieved a series of stunning victories on the battlefield. He defeated the Persian king Darius III at the Battle of Issus in 333 BCE, and again at the Battle of Gaugamela in 331 BCE. He then continued his conquests into Central Asia and India, where he faced fierce resistance from local armies and encountered new cultures and religions. Despite facing numerous challenges and setbacks, Alexander was a brilliant military strategist who was able to adapt to changing circumstances and inspire his troops to victory. He was known for leading his soldiers from the front, and he fought alongside them in many battles. His leadership style earned him the loyalty and admiration of his soldiers, who were willing to follow him to the ends of the earth. In addition to his military conquests, Alexander was also a skilled politician and diplomat. He understood the importance of winning over the hearts and minds of the people he conquered, and he adopted many of the customs and traditions of the cultures he encountered. He also founded several new cities, including Alexandria in Egypt, which became a major center of learning and culture in the ancient world. Despite his many successes, Alexander's life was cut tragically short. He died in 323 BCE at the age of 32, possibly from malaria or poisoning. His death left a power vacuum in his empire, which led to a period of instability and conflict known as the Wars of the Diadochi. Today, Alexander is remembered as one of the greatest military commanders in history. His conquests had a profound impact on the ancient world, spreading Greek culture and Hellenistic ideas throughout the Mediterranean and Near East. His legacy also lives on in the many cities he founded, which served as centers of trade, commerce, and learning for centuries to come. Alexander the Great was a remarkable leader who left an indelible mark on history. He was a brilliant military strategist, a skilled politician, and a charismatic leader who inspired loyalty and devotion from his soldiers. His legacy continues to be felt today, and his story serves as a reminder of the power of human ambition, courage, and determination.
